Preparation of the workplace and the necessary tools

Before starting any manipulations with the body of the refrigeration unit, it is necessary to prepare the space. Working with large equipment requires freedom of movement, so make sure there is enough space around the device to walk around on all sides. Disconnect the device from the power supply by removing the plug from the socket and let it stand for at least 15-20 minutes so that the oil in the compressor flows into the crankcase if it has just been running.

To perform the work, you will need a basic set of tools, which is usually in the arsenal of a home craftsman. The main tool will be screwdriver or a set of screwdrivers with different tips (phillips and flat). It would also be a good idea to have a wrench on hand, the size of which corresponds to the hinge fastening bolts, and pliers.

Pay special attention to preparing the surface on which the removed element will be temporarily installed. Place thick cardboard, a blanket or soft cloth on the floor to avoid scratching the decorative covering of the door when dismantling it. It is also recommended to cover the floor in the work area, since when unscrewing the bolts, small parts may fall and get lost in the carpet pile or floor cracks.

⚠️ Attention: Before starting work, be sure to empty the door shelves of food and bottles. Even a small weight of the contents can shift the center of gravity and complicate the removal process, and spilled oil or broken glass will create a dangerous situation.

Design features of Stinol models

Refrigerators Stinol, produced in different years, may have different door fastening designs. In most cases, the classic scheme with an upper and lower hinge is used, however, the location of fasteners and the presence of additional parts may vary depending on the series. For example, in models with a system No Frost there are often additional air ducts that require caution when dismantling.

It is important to consider that some models are equipped with an electronic display or control buttons located on the facade. In such cases, the procedure is complicated by the need to disconnect the wire loops. If your model does not have electronics on the door, the task is greatly simplified, since you do not need to worry about the integrity of the wiring.

It is also worth paying attention to the type of handles. In some models they can be integrated into the body, in others they can be screwed separately. If the handle interferes with access to the bottom hinge mounting bolts, it may need to be removed first. Study the design carefully before applying force.

Step-by-step instructions for dismantling the upper door

You should always start the reinstallation process from the top of the unit. First, remove the decorative cap from the top hinge, if present. Usually it is pryed off with a flat screwdriver or simply removed by hand. Under it you will find fastening bolts that need to be unscrewed.

After loosening the fasteners, the upper door must be held, since it no longer holds anything. It is better to perform this operation together: one person holds the heavy element, and the second finally unscrews the bolts and removes the hinge. Carefully remove the top door and set it aside in a safe place, first placing it on a prepared soft surface.

If there is a shelf or decorative element installed on the top door that interferes with further work, remove it now. In models with a freezer on top, this part is the first to be removed, freeing up access to the middle part of the body, if we are talking about three-chamber models or units of great height.

Inspect the removed hinge. Often rubber seals or bushings remain on it. Be careful not to lose them as they will be needed when installing on the other side. If there are traces of corrosion or contamination on the hinge, it is better to clean them before reinstallation to ensure smooth movement of the door in the future.

Removing the middle and lower parts

After removing the upper door, access to the middle hinge (if the model is two-chamber) or directly to the lower part opens. In two-chamber refrigerators Stinol the middle hinge is often combined with the axis on which the upper chamber rests. It also needs to be unscrewed.

After removing the middle hinge, carefully lift and remove the bottom door (freezer compartment). Proceed with caution as this part often contains a snap mechanism or magnetic seal that may require force to remove, but should be avoided. Place the door on the prepared place.

Now you need to remove the lower support hinge. It is attached to the refrigerator body with bolts. After removing it, you will have the entire set of loops on your hands, which will need to be rearranged to the opposite side. In some models, along with the hinges, the axle pins on which the door is hung are also removed.

⚠️ Attention: When removing the lower hinge, check the condition of the adjusting screws. If they are rusty or hard to move, treat them with a penetrating lubricant (for example, WD-40) in advance so as not to strip the threads when you try to unscrew them.

An important step is to rearrange the handles. If the design of your model requires rearranging the handles, remove them from one side of the door and install them on the other using the holes provided by the manufacturer. Often, the same fasteners are used for this, simply screwed on the reverse side.

Installing hinges on the new side

When all the elements are dismantled, we proceed to installation on the opposite side. The refrigerator body Stinol initially has technological holes on both sides. Those holes that were used are closed with plastic plugs, which must be removed and moved to the free side.

Start by installing the lower support loop. Insert it into the designated holes on the new side and tighten the bolts. Do not tighten them all the way straight away to allow for (fine adjustment) of the position. Install the lower door onto the axis of the lower hinge.

Next, install the middle hinge (for two-chamber models). Thread the axle through the hole in the bottom door and secure the hinge to the body. Then the upper door is hung. Make sure that all axes fit into the corresponding bushings on the doors.

After hanging all the doors, check their movement. They should open and close freely, without jamming or creaking. If the door touches the body or the seal does not fit tightly around the entire perimeter, you will need to adjust the height of the refrigerator legs or the position of the hinges.

What to do if the door does not close tightly?

If after reinstallation you notice that the door does not fit tightly, check to see if the seal is twisted in the grooves. It is also possible that the floor on which the refrigerator sits is sloped. In this case, it is necessary to unscrew the front adjusting legs to give the body a slight tilt back - this will help the door close under the influence of gravity.

Working with electronics and sensors

Refrigerator models Stinolequipped with electronic controls located on the door deserve special attention. In such devices, when rehanging, it is necessary to disconnect the cables running from the case to the control panel.

Usually the connectors are located in the upper part, next to the loop. Before disconnecting, make sure that the refrigerator is unplugged. Carefully disconnect the chips, being careful not to pull the wires. When assembling on the new side, make sure that the wires are long enough to connect and are not pinched by the loop mechanism.

In some cases, it may be necessary to rearrange the control module itself or change the configuration of the wires inside the case if the factory length of the cables does not allow you to simply throw them to the other side. In such situations, it is better to refer to the technical documentation of the specific model.

⚠️ Attention: If you are not confident in your skills in working with electrical circuits, it is better not to take risks. Incorrect connection of the cable can damage the control unit refrigerator, the repair of which will cost much more than calling a technician.

Adjustment and check of installation quality

The final stage is a thorough check and adjustment. Close the door and evaluate the gap between the seal and the body around the entire perimeter. It should be uniform. If the door does not fit tightly at the top or bottom, you can slightly loosen the hinge mounting bolts and slightly move the door, then tighten the bolts again.

Check the operation of the magnetic latches and the tightness. To do this, you can use a simple test with a sheet of paper: hold the sheet with a door and try to pull it out. If the sheet is pulled out with force along the entire perimeter, then the seal is good. If in some place the sheet slides out freely, adjustment is required.

Also make sure that when the door is opened to a certain angle, it does not slam back on its own (if this is not provided for by the design) and does not require excessive force to close. A correctly installed door should operate silently and smoothly.

After completing the work, turn on the refrigerator. Let it run for several hours without loading food to make sure it is stable and there are no problems with the seal of the chamber.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)

Do you need to completely defrost the refrigerator before rehanging it?

Full defrosting is not strictly necessary if you work quickly. However, if there is a lot of ice in the refrigerator or food that could fall out when tilted (which sometimes happens when removing doors), it is better to defrost it in advance. This will also lighten the weight of the structure.

Is it possible to hang the door by one person?

Technically this is possible, but it is highly not recommended. Refrigerator doors, especially double-chamber ones, are heavy and bulky. Without an assistant, there is a high risk of dropping the door, damaging the floor, legs or the equipment itself. Involve a second person for backup.

What to do if the plugs for the holes are lost?

If the plastic plugs are lost, the holes can be sealed with decorative film in the color of the case or use plugs from another, less noticeable part of the case, if they are the right size. You can also order them at a service center or pick up universal fittings in a store.

Why did the door begin to open on its own after rehanging?

Most likely, the angle of the body is broken. The door should open itself only when the opening angle is more than 90 degrees (depending on the model). If it opens at a lower angle, then the front of the refrigerator is too raised. Try to tighten the front adjusting feet, lowering the front part a little lower.
